Job Summary

About the Team:

The Real-time Architectures Integration and Demonstration (RAID) Group focuses on transition of algorithms from concept to real-time software providing open architecture expertise and facilitating integration of capabilities for experimentation test and deployment.

The Role:

As a Senior Software Engineer for Integration and Test you will focus on supporting the development integration and validation of real-time RF sensor software systems. You will work as part of a multi-disciplinary team to implement software components integrate algorithms into open architecture frameworks and develop test infrastructure to validate system performance. This role emphasizes hands-on software development open system integration integrating software components across distributed architectures and with hardware platforms and rigorous testing of real-time applications.

What you will do:

  • Implement software components for real-time sensor systems in C/C
  • Integrate signal processing algorithms into open architecture software frameworks
  • Develop and execute integration tests and system-level validation tests
  • Debug software issues in real-time multi-threaded and distributed systems
  • Work with senior engineers to translate algorithm specifications into software implementations
  • Develop test scripts and automated testing infrastructure
  • Perform hands-on lab work with signal processing hardware and test equipment
  • Document software designs test procedures results and technical reports
  • Support system demonstrations and field testing activities
  • Participate in code reviews and contribute to software quality improvements
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ams including algorithm developers systems engineers and integration staff
  • Support approximately 20% travel for integration events field testing and customer demonstrations

STR is a growing technology company with locations near Boston MA Arlington VA near Dayton OH Melbourne FL and Carlsbad CA. We specialize in advanced research and development for defense intelligence and national security in: cyber; next generation sensors radar sonar communications and electronic warfare; and artificial intelligence algorithms and analytics to make sense of the complexity that is exploding around us.
